February snowstorm in Texas hits tanker companies

February's major snowstorm, which covered much of the US, also hit the country's crude oil production in Texas, causing bad news for tanker companies, assesses Bimco.

The beginning of 2021 saw the largest drop in US oil production since 2018, largely due to the February snowstorm that hit large parts of the US, including Texas, the country's main oil state.
